HAZARD

RISk OF HOT SURFACES

WHAT CAN HAPPEN

HOW TO PREVENT IT

• Touching exposed metal such

as the compressor head, engine

head, engine exhaust or outlet

tubes, can result in serious burns.

• Never touch any exposed metal

parts on compressor during or

immediately after operation.

Compressor will remain hot for

several minutes after operation.

• Do not reach around protective

shrouds or attempt maintenance

until unit has been allowed to cool.

HAZARD

RISk FROM MOVING PARTS

WHAT CAN HAPPEN

HOW TO PREVENT IT

• Moving parts such as the pulley,

flywheel, and belt can cause seri-

ous injury if they come into con-

tact with you or your clothing.

• Never operate the compres-

sor with guards or covers which

are damaged or removed.

• Keep your hair, clothing, and

gloves away from moving parts.

Loose clothes, jewelry, or long hair

can be caught in moving parts.

• Air vents may cover moving parts

and should be avoided as well.

• Attempting to operate compressor

with damaged or missing parts or

attempting to repair compressor

with protective shrouds removed

can expose you to moving parts

and can result in serious injury.

• Any repairs required on this product

should be performed by autho-

rized service center personnel.
